
Kevin Considers: Take It Like a True Fan
Like many sports fans on campus, I was watching game seven of the Bruins and Capitals playoff series. As everyone is now aware, the Bruins ended up losing by a final score of 2-1.
As there are a fair number of Bruins fans on this campus, you could probably guess that there were a lot of people upset about this loss. Let me start by saying that I was just as disappointed as anyone else that they lost. I wasn't, however, about to head out of my room yelling and scream, slamming doors, and acting as if this was the worst thing in the world. I mean, hey, the Bruins could have not made the playoffs, like a certain team from Montreal.
Where is this passion in LSC sports games? Where are the fiery fans getting upset when their school's soccer team makes the NAC finals, or when the basketball team makes the NAC playoffs? I guess it just shows one thing, and that is that some people just can't act like they've been there before.
NEWS FLASH! The Bruins, who were the second seeded team in the eastern conference of the NHL playoffs, JUST won the Stanley cup last year. How spoiled can we be as fans? Like I said, I'm disappointed as a fan, but I'm more disappointed in the way fans, that I saw, reacted to this loss.
Some teams, from professional to collegiate, have never even been in a playoff game. Many fans would be happy, just to make the playoffs. In a lot of sports, just getting to the post season is hard enough.
As fans of Lyndon State athletics, I think we should be able to understand and not take for granted that your team isn't always going to be the best. So support them through the lows, and through the highs of their seasons, and THEN, you can act like you've been there before.
